Protect yourself with 2FA
Two-factor authentication, or 2FA, isn't a silver bullet -- but it exponentially increases your online safety by adding an extra step to the login process that a hacker/scammer does not have access to.
Every account that you care about (and even those you don't) should have some form of 2FA enabled.
Especially email -- should your email become compromised, this can become a catastrophe.
(For websites that don't support 2FA, use a burner email!)
What 2FA should I use?
2FA can take many forms, from the highly convenient (SMS, email) to the highly secure (security keys), but one thing is certain:
Any form of 2FA is better than nothing.
The simplest forms of 2FA are phone number or email. While these are very easy to use, they are unfortunately not very secure.
Still, I repeat: despite their flaws, these forms of 2FA are absolutely, 100% better than not having any 2FA at all.
On the other end of the spectrum, security keys (like for example a Yubikey) are extremely secure, but they cost money and are a bit of a hassle at time. I use them, but for most people, it's overkill.
What you want is an authenticator app.
Important
A note, before we go on…
If you enable multiple forms of 2FA, how secure your account is will depend on your weakest link.
For example, if you enable SMS authentication AND register a security key, your account will only be as safe as the SMS authentication. The security key is essentially useless.
In other words, the least secure form of 2FA you add determines the overall security of your account.
Sometimes, less is more!
Authenticator Apps
First, choose a free, reputable authenticator. Google Authenticator is a good choice. So are Aegis Authenticator or Microsoft Authenticator.
For simplicity, we'll go with Google Authenticator; the process is rather similar for most authenticators.
First, download the app from your app store and install it on your phone.
Enrolling Gmail into GA
Securing your email should be your number 1 priority, so let's enroll a Google account to Google Authenticator.
Let's enable two-step verification first.
Phone number is better than nothing, but not very safe (SMS verification can be spoofed), so let's click on "Add authenticator app".
Click on "Set up authenticator". Google will generate a QR-code.
Next, go back to your phone and click on the little multicolored cross. It will bring up a menu; click on "scan a QR code".

Go ahead and scan the QR code.
Congratulations, you have enrolled your Google account!
Now, whenever you are asked for a 2FA code, just open the app and copy/paste it.
Note: the codes are stored locally on your phone.
Enabling 2FA on Discord
The process is fairly similar. Go to Settings > My Account:
Click on "Enable Authenticator App". You will be prompted for your password. Enter it.
Download Google Authenticator if you haven't already. Scan the QR code as described above.
Do take the time to download your backup codes as well!
As explained above, I personally do not recommend setting up SMS authentication here, since authenticator apps are supported, as this weakens the overall security of your account for little benefit.

In 2024, I will walk into a physical space—a restaurant, a hairdresser, an arts venue, an artisanal cheese shop—and instead of being handed a physical piece of paper with some useful information on it, or being told it in words, I will be shown a faded roundel with a QR code on it. I will hold my phone’s camera up to it wearily. Sometimes it will work, but the font on the menu or the information will be small. I’ll have to enlarge it and take my glasses off to read it, because I’ve reached that age. Sometimes it won’t work at all. Sometimes the information on it will be out of date.
In all cases, many people—some elderly, others with access needs, children, anyone who just doesn’t fancy constantly looking at their phone—will be pushed toward more useless screen time and away from the kind of brief, friendly interactions with other humans that help us all feel part of the fabric of life. We’ll have reached the point of overdigitization.
It's not that there aren’t more gains to be made in technology. Incredible things are happening in biotech, especially since the pandemic. The world of continuous glucose monitors and lateral flow tests (LFT) will keep growing. In 2024 we will see new kinds of LFTs that test for other infections and problems. We will see more useful work in truly personalized medicine. But in the UK, at least, the benefit of those innovations will be increasingly available only for those who can pay for it themselves. The division between the technological haves and have-nots will only continue to grow.
And although technology will continue to flourish, my guess is that the truly big gains in digital communication have now been made for a generation. If there’s innovation to come in digital communication it will be in the field of overdigitization, using screens where paper and actual words from real people both work better. We could—and should—use this next decade to shore up the gains we’ve made for all members of society. But I predict that, in 2024, we won’t. The Good Things Foundation estimates that 10 million people in the UK lack the basic digital skills needed to access the modern world. And 6.9 million people will continue to be excluded if they’re not given proactive help. But the current British government doesn’t seem much interested in raising the floor for the worst off.
These things can’t be done by individual companies, which come up with good-sounding ideas like, “why don’t we let people order a coffee while they’re getting their hair done, using a QR code!” It’s exactly the kind of things that incorrigibly urban WIRED readers like me think would be fun to use—but companies don’t tend to think about how to help people who aren’t going to spend money with them, or who are too put off by over-exuberant digital-everywhere to actually go into the shop.
Companies can look after their employees. And they can work to overcome that other half of the overdigitization problem: that many jobs are becoming more boring and isolated because they involve the equivalents of more pointing-at-QR-code-roundels and less actual interaction with people. But while companies can think about employees and about good customer service, thinking about improving equality and fairness is the job of government, not businesses.
There is of course one thing I can predict with total certainty for the UK in 2024: That the British public will get to have their own say on digital inequality and a whole host of other issues. Because, in 2024, Parliament will be dissolved in advance of an election.

Ok so I’m gonna go on a LONG neurodivergent rant here. As much as I loathe the QR code thing and *strongly* prefer holding a physical menu, I actually get why they do this and there are several benefits to having a QR code.
First of all, it’s way more hygienic. You don’t know who else touched the menu you’re holding, how well they sanitized it, where it’s been, etc. I’ve seen people put my menu back in the pile it came from. Whether that was breaking the rules I have no clue.
Second, physical menus can become obsolete over time. Usually by physically wearing down. I’ve held menus with the lamination peeling off, a weird crease in the middle, etc. But what if they want to update their menu? What if they add a new dish or remove a dish? They’d have to reprint all the menus, and what happens to the old ones? They just get thrown out. And since you cannot recycle laminated paper (https://nobelusuniversity.com/2023/01/05/can-you-recycle-laminated-paper/#:~:text=As%20a%20lamination%20supplier%2C%20Nobelus,product%20from%20yielding%20useful%20materials.), they likely just go in the landfill. Not great for the environment.
Thirdly, QR code menus have a lot more potential for accessibility. If someone blind is using a screen reader, for example, or someone uses a large font on their phone, a digital menu allows them to use those accessibility features. You can’t change the font on a physical menu, and I’ve definitely had a hard time reading some tint text.
Fourthly, it allows for proper web design. This may sound stupid because DUH, it’s a website, but just hear me out. A good website will have features like drop down menus, a search bar, selecting by category, etc. This means that unlike a physical menu, you aren’t immediately hit with a giant wall of text with like 30 different dishes on it. You can say “hey I want a sandwich, can I see the sandwiches?” And the website’s like “sure, here’s all the sandwiches in one little category!” And a website also allows the restaurant to 86 things “like hey we’re out of tomatoes, so this dish won’t have tomatoes in it, is that ok?”
Not to mention, I’m not sure if any place does this but it may even allow you to DIGITALLY PAY IN ADVANCE rather than wait for the check, which I strongly prefer because I don’t like thinking about when the check is gonna come or when I can flag down the waiter, I just wanna enjoy my food and relax. And I love using Apple Pay tbh.
TLDR:
Physical menus can be unsanitary, can wear down, can’t be edited, aren’t good for the environment as they can’t be recycled, can be overwhelming to read, and lack accessibility features. QR code menus have all the features your web browser does, and up to the restaurant’s discretion can be well designed, edited at any time, and if you can pay immediately through it, REPLACE THE WAITER ENTIRELY.
So, I like holding a physical menu, it feels correct to me. But from an analytical standpoint, those places are making a good decision.

A barcode is a visual representation of data using parallel lines (in 1D barcodes) or squares and patterns (in 2D barcodes like QR codes). This code is scanned using machines to retrieve the encoded information instantly.
The purpose of Barcode Definitions is to explain what barcodes are and how they enable businesses to streamline tracking, inventory, and point-of-sale systems. Barcodes are now used in retail, healthcare, logistics, catering, and countless other sectors.
2. How Barcodes Work: A Quick Technical Breakdown
Understanding how barcodes function helps bring clarity to Barcode Definitions. Each barcode is designed to hold specific data such as a product ID, location, batch number, or price. A scanner uses light sensors to read the code and instantly translate it into readable data for a computer system.
The scanner decodes the reflected light from the barcode and converts it into digital signals. These signals are matched with backend systems to identify the item or data linked to the code. This makes barcodes a fast and efficient solution for real-time tracking and management.
3. Common Types of Barcodes Used in 2025
When looking at Barcode Definitions, it’s important to know the various types available today:
1D Barcodes (like UPC or EAN): These are linear and used mainly in retail.
2D Barcodes (like QR Codes and Data Matrix): These carry more data in less space.
PDF417: Used in official documents like driving licenses or airline boarding passes.
GS1 Barcodes: Global standards for supply chains and retail.
Each of these fits under the umbrella of modern Barcode Definitions and helps businesses choose the best format for their needs.

1. Locally Sourced & Seasonal Flowers
One of the most effective ways to reduce the environmental footprint of wedding décor is to use flowers that are locally grown and in season. Not only does this support regional farmers, but it also ensures fresher blooms and minimizes emissions from transportation.
Design Tip: Pair seasonal florals with foraged greenery for a whimsical, garden-fresh look that feels organic and luxurious.
2. Foam-Free Floral Design
Traditional floral foam is non-biodegradable and toxic. The shift towards foam-free floral installations is a big step in sustainable design. Floral designers now use chicken wire, reusable cages, or water tubes to craft intricate arrangements without compromising the environment.
Why It Matters: Foam-free techniques promote reuse and allow for more creative, free-form designs that feel natural and alive.
3. Reusable & Versatile Decor Elements
From ceremony backdrops to tabletop accents, investing in reusable décor is both stylish and smart. Elements like brass vases, handwoven baskets, ceramic urns, wooden arches, and drapes can be reused across multiple events or even repurposed by the couple after the wedding.
Studio Insight: At Meghaa Modi Design Studio, we curate a library of versatile décor elements that can be customized for each event without waste.
4. Repurposing Florals Across Events
A growing trend is reusing florals across different functions within the same wedding. For example, mandap florals can be repurposed for the reception stage, or table arrangements can be moved from the welcome dinner to the mehendi setup.
Benefits: This approach not only reduces waste but also offers continuity in design, creating a cohesive visual story across the wedding festivities.
5. Digital Invitations & Paperless Touchpoints
While printed wedding stationery has its charm, digital invitations and QR-code RSVPs are becoming the go-to choice for eco-conscious couples. Even menus, table numbers, and welcome notes can be displayed digitally or printed on recycled paper using sustainable inks.
Modern Aesthetic: Digital invites can be just as luxurious when paired with elegant animations, custom illustrations, and interactive features.
6. Eco-Friendly Fabrics & Textiles
Choosing organic or recycled fabrics for drapes, table runners, and cushions is a subtle yet powerful way to go green. Natural materials like cotton, muslin, and jute are not only sustainable but also add texture and warmth to the décor.
Trend Watch: Botanical-dyed fabrics and handloom linens are gaining popularity in 2025 for their earthy charm and artisanal appeal.
7. Flower Donation & Composting
After the celebration ends, what happens to all the beautiful blooms? Many couples now choose to donate their flowers to hospitals, NGOs, or elderly homes—spreading joy even after the wedding. Composting floral waste is also gaining traction as a responsible post-event practice.
Impactful Gesture: Flower donations create a meaningful legacy and turn your wedding into a source of joy for others.

Standard (static) QR codes serve one purpose: they redirect users to a fixed URL. That’s it. No tracking, no updates, no control. In today’s fast-moving world of marketing, that just doesn’t cut it.
Enter the trackable QR code generator, a modern solution that goes far beyond the basics.
What Is a Trackable QR Code Generator?
A trackable QR code generator creates dynamic QR codes that can be updated anytime and come equipped with detailed analytics. Every time someone scans your code, you get valuable data such as:
Scan count
Date and time
User location
Device type
Repeat vs. unique scans
This level of insight transforms your QR codes into measurable assets in your marketing toolkit.
Benefits for Your Business
Here’s why forward-thinking businesses are switching to trackable QR codes:
📊 Real-Time Analytics
Monitor how your QR campaigns are performing in different regions, on different materials, and at different times of the day.
🔄 Editable Links
Promotions change. Products evolve. With dynamic QR codes, you can update the destination URL anytime—without reprinting the code.
💼 Campaign-Level Control
Group your QR codes by campaign to measure which efforts are driving the most engagement.
